Core Viewpoint - The Ministry of Industry and Information Technology has announced the public disclosure of a mandatory national standard project titled "Classification and Identification Requirements for Digital Human Identity" as part of the overall standardization efforts [1] Industry Overview - The digital human industry in China has experienced rapid growth, with over 1.14 million related enterprises currently operating [1] - From November 2024 to May 2025, an additional 174,000 new registered enterprises are expected to emerge in this sector [1] - It is projected that by 2025, the scale of China's digital human industry will exceed 40 billion yuan, driving the surrounding industry scale to over 600 billion yuan [1] Application Scenarios - Digital humans are widely utilized in various fields, including performance hosting, e-commerce live streaming, brand marketing, customer service, and education and training, indicating a broad range of application scenarios [1] Challenges - Despite the rapid development of the digital human industry, significant risks have emerged, particularly due to the lack of an effective digital human identity management mechanism, leading to a proliferation of unidentified digital human images in the internet space [1]
